Dynamics of simplified HPT model in relation to 24h TSH profiles

We propose a simplified mathematical model of the hypothalamus-pituitary-thyroid (HPT) axis in an endocrine system. The considered model is a modification of the model proposed by Mukhopadhyay in [9]. Our system of delay differential equations reconstructs the HPT-axis in relation to 24h profiles of human in physiological conditions. Homeostatic control of the thyroid-pituitary axis is considered by using feedback and delay in our model. The influence of delayed feedback on the stability behaviour of the system is discussed.
